Veterinary technology is a specialized branch of animal healthcare where technicians (vet techs) perform diagnostic, therapeutic, and surgical support under the supervision of licensed veterinarians. Unlike veterinary assistants, who focus on non-clinical tasks like cleaning cages or feeding animals, vet techs undergo formal education—typically an associate degree (though bachelor’s programs are growing)—and are required to pass state licensing exams. The term "vet tech define" thus hinges on three pillars: education, licensure, and clinical autonomy. Their duties span from lab work (running blood panels, urinalysis) to advanced procedures (assisting in orthopedic surgery, managing ICU patients), with a legal scope that varies by state but generally includes administering medications, taking X-rays, and even performing minor surgeries in some jurisdictions.

Core Mechanisms: How It Works

At its core, veterinary technology operates on a triad of education, licensure, and collaborative practice. The educational pathway typically starts with an associate degree (2 years) from an AVMA-accredited program, covering subjects like pharmacology, anesthesia, and surgical assisting. Some vet techs pursue bachelor’s degrees for specialization or to qualify for advanced roles, such as veterinary technician specialists (VTS). Licensure varies by state but usually requires passing the Veterinary Technician National Exam (VTNE) and meeting continuing education requirements. Once licensed, vet techs work under a veterinarian’s supervision, but their autonomy includes performing tasks like:

  • Collecting and analyzing lab samples (blood, urine, fecal matter)
  • Administering medications and vaccinations
  • Assisting in surgical procedures (prepping patients, monitoring vitals)
  • Educating clients on preventive care and chronic disease management
  • Operating diagnostic equipment (ultrasound, X-ray machines)

The collaborative nature of the role is critical—vet techs often serve as the primary point of contact for clients, translating complex medical jargon into actionable advice. For instance, when a dog owner asks, *"Why is my pet limping?"* the vet tech might conduct a preliminary assessment, take radiographs, and relay findings to the veterinarian before discussing treatment options. This interplay between technical skill and communication is what vet tech define encompasses.

The profession’s mechanics also adapt to species-specific needs. A vet tech in a small animal clinic will focus on companion animals (dogs, cats), while one in equine practice might specialize in lameness exams or reproductive procedures. Exotic animal vet techs, meanwhile, work with reptiles, birds, or zoo species, requiring knowledge of unique husbandry and disease patterns. Comparative Analysis

To clarify the vet tech define, it’s essential to compare it with related roles in animal healthcare. Below is a side-by-side breakdown of key differences:

Role Education/Licensure Scope of Practice Salary Range (2024)
Veterinary Technician (Vet Tech) Associate or bachelor’s degree + state licensure (VTNE) Diagnostics, medications, surgical assisting, client education $35,000–$65,000
Veterinary Assistant On-the-job training or short certificate programs (no licensure required) Basic care (feeding, cleaning), restraining animals, non-clinical tasks $25,000–$35,000
Veterinarian (DVM) Doctoral degree (4 years post-baccalaureate) + state licensure Diagnosis, treatment, surgery, business ownership $90,000–$180,000+
Animal Caregiver (e.g., Kennel Attendant) No formal education required Feeding, exercise, basic grooming $20,000–$30,000

While veterinary assistants and caregivers provide valuable support, the vet tech define emphasizes a higher level of medical training and responsibility. For example, a vet tech can interpret lab results and administer anesthesia, whereas an assistant cannot. Q: How long does it take to become a vet tech?

A: Most vet techs complete an associate degree (2 years) from an AVMA-accredited program, followed by licensure exams. Bachelor’s programs take 4 years and may be required for advanced roles. Online or hybrid programs can accelerate timelines for working professionals.

Q: Can vet techs work independently without a veterinarian?

A: No. Vet techs must work under the direct supervision of a licensed veterinarian, as their scope of practice is legally defined by state veterinary boards. However, they can perform delegated tasks (e.g., medications, diagnostics) without constant oversight in many settings.

Q: What’s the hardest part of being a vet tech?

A: Many vet techs cite emotional challenges—such as euthanasia support or managing owner distress—as the most difficult aspects. Physical demands (lifting animals, long hours) and the pressure of high-stakes procedures (e.g., emergency surgeries) also contribute to job stress.

Q: Are vet techs in demand internationally?

A: Yes, but requirements vary. In the U.S., licensure is state-specific; in Canada, vet techs must pass the National Veterinary Technician Exam (NVTE). The UK and Australia use titles like "veterinary nurse," with different education pathways. Demand is highest in countries with growing pet populations or veterinary shortages.

Q: How can vet techs advance their careers?

A: Specializations (e.g., veterinary technician specialist in dentistry or anesthesia) require additional certifications and experience. Leadership roles, such as clinic manager or veterinary practice consultant, often require a bachelor’s degree and years of practice. Continuing education credits are mandatory for license renewal.

Q: What’s the biggest misconception about vet techs?

A: Many assume vet techs are "just groomers or animal sitters." In reality, their work is medically complex, requiring knowledge of pharmacology, surgical assisting, and diagnostic imaging—similar to human medical technicians but with an animal-specific focus.

Q: Do vet techs get paid more in certain specialties?

A: Yes. Vet techs in anesthesia, emergency care, or research settings often earn 20–30% more than those in general practice. Exotic animal or equine specialists may also command higher salaries due to niche expertise and equipment costs.

Q: Can vet techs prescribe medications?

A: No. Vet techs cannot prescribe medications; that authority lies solely with veterinarians. However, they can administer prescribed medications under a vet’s direction and educate owners on proper usage.
